> We're using the pfLightSource mechanism on an Onyx2 with iR
> graphics to generate shadows in our application. We have found
> that with certain camera positions, some garbage geometry appears
> to be creating a shadow; by moving the camera slightly, the
> effect goes away.

I have also been using pfLightSource shadows on our Onyx iR (which has
patch 1808 installed) and have noticed the anomalies that you describe. The
only explanation I can think of is that the floor geometry is actually
shadowing itself in these situations. I had a quick go with different
values for the shadow displace and scale but couldn't come up with a
satisfactory set up.
